* Package name : python-hardware
Description : hardware detection and classification utilities
Detect hardware features of a Linux systems:
* RAID
* hard drives
* IPMI
* network cards
* DMI infos
* memory settings
* processor features
.
Filter hardware according to hardware profiles.

FYI, that's a dependency of ironic-python-agent [1], which does hardware
discovery and image install for Ironic. I've just uploaded both packages
and I intend to deploy my first Ironic-enabled cloud soonish. :)
